How to fill out parent non-tax-filer statement

Illustration

How to fill out parent non-tax-filer statement?

01
Gather the necessary information: Before filling out the parent non-tax-filer statement, ensure you have the following information ready - your parent's full name, address, social security number, and date of birth.
02
Obtain the appropriate form: Contact the organization or institution that requires the parent non-tax-filer statement to obtain the correct form. This may be a financial aid office, a scholarship program, or any other entity requesting this documentation.
03
Fill out personal information: Start by providing your own personal information at the top of the form, including your name, address, social security number, and any other required details.
04
Input parent's information: In the designated sections of the form, accurately enter your parent's full name, address, social security number, and date of birth. Double-check the information to ensure accuracy.
05
Indicate non-tax-filer status: The form will contain a section where you need to specify that your parent did not file a tax return for the specified year. This is typically due to their income being below the threshold that requires them to file.
06
Verify income details: Some forms might require you to provide additional information regarding your parent's income, such as the sources of income or the amount earned. Make sure to accurately fill out these details if required.
07
Include any necessary supporting documents: Check if the form requests any supporting documents to substantiate your parent's non-tax-filer status. These may include statements from employers, unemployment documents, or any other relevant paperwork.
08
Sign and date the form: Once you have completed the form and verified all the information, sign and date it as required. Ensure your parent does the same if their signature is needed.
09
Submit the form: Follow the instructions provided by the organization or institution to submit the parent non-tax-filer statement. This may involve mailing the form, submitting it electronically, or delivering it in person.

Who needs parent non-tax-filer statement?

01
Students applying for financial aid: Many colleges, universities, and scholarship programs require a parent non-tax-filer statement to assess a student's eligibility for financial aid.
02
Dependent students applying for grants or loans: Government grants and loans often require documentation of the parent's non-tax-filer status to determine the student's financial need.
03
Non-filing parents claiming dependents: Parents who did not file a tax return but have dependents may need to provide a non-tax-filer statement to establish their dependent status for various purposes, such as claiming dependents on their healthcare coverage or child support calculations.

Parent non-tax-filer statement is a form used to declare that a parent did not file a tax return for the applicable year.
Parents who did not file a tax return for the year in question are required to file the parent non-tax-filer statement.
To fill out the parent non-tax-filer statement, parents must provide their personal information and sign the declaration that they did not file a tax return.
The purpose of the parent non-tax-filer statement is to verify that a parent did not file a tax return for the applicable year.
Parents must report their personal information, including their name, social security number, and other relevant details.
